Joseph Yang writes:
>What SCSI problems were they (just wondering since I'm having such problems)
>I know (think) there is a problem with the Advansys driver it always hangs
>my machine when it is loaded as a module - if not then, it will hang when 
>I try to mount the CD-Writer which is attached to the Advansys SCSI. Since
>I'm not near my Linux machine I can't really give any further details. But
>will post later tonite about it. 
>
>Has anyone on the list had similar problems with the Advansys driver? Using
>the module options posted earlier by Michael(??) did not fix the problem.

It's a bug in the midlevel SCSI code which only showed up in drivers for
SCSI adaptors we didn't have here to try...  :-(

Read ftp://ftp.redhat.com/johnsonm/README and for instructions.  You need
the bootadvansys.img.gz boot image, but without reading the README it
won't help you any.

The information there is slotted for the next errata update.
